Output ed5018cce25000b557b0a9ef27116274faf003aae81f388e5a1e31080bfac9d4:0

value
517923
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69afbc5308f76b4dc6e592fe4954269a30360712 OP_EQUAL
address
3BKqQ1g2FFiWmxXH4945bSQqY6R496oW2r
transaction
ed5018cce25000b557b0a9ef27116274faf003aae81f388e5a1e31080bfac9d4
spent
true